Ticket: connection failures traced to Larkspan component library version skew

Support team: several tenants report connection failures in the Dovewell dashboard. Root cause is a version mismatch — apps pinned to Larkspan 3.x still use the old connection helper, which drops retries, while 4.x handles failover correctly. Please check the tenant's reported library version before escalating; anything below 4.1 should be asked to upgrade. To verify tenant state yourself, query the registry database using the connection string below.

primary connection of yagep-kahip = redis://giliel_svc:zYiKsLL2PLpfPL@db-348f.xolmarsys.corp:5432/fenwyn

# Pricing Experiment: Variant C (Tierline project)
# This block gates the dynamic ticket-pricing experiment for the Harbrook venue cluster.
# Note for review: prices are computed server-side only; the client never sees raw
# multipliers, and all assignments are logged to the audit table for replay.
# Rollback is a single flag flip; no data migration required.
# The experiment service reads assignments from the database at the connection string below.

warehouse DSN: mssql://rusdor_svc:0FSWCn9@db-951a.paliqforge.local:5432/ulawyn

Capacity note for the Fabrikit test-data factory library. Current generation throughput on the Larkspool CI pool is about 12k rows/sec per worker, which is fine for unit suites but stalls the nightly integration runs once fixture graphs exceed 200k entities. We plan to raise the pool size and batch window, and cap recursive trait expansion to avoid memory spikes seen last sprint. Reviewers should check the deltas against the defaults in the Fabrikit core config. The proposed tuning constants are as follows.

tuning constants:
QUOTAS = {
    "druwyn": 5,
    "holix": 5,
    "zorath": 5,
    "holwyn": 10,
}